The FNA is ordered because two biggest nodules are more then 1 cm in size and the increased color flow is present.
However: “We determined that color Doppler cannot reliably distinguish benign from malignant thyroid nodules; fine-needle aspiration biopsy remains the most accurate method in differentiating benign and malignant lesions. We suggest that color Doppler sonography plays only a LIMITED role in the evaluation of nodular thyroid disease at this time.” Source:
Color Doppler sonography: Anatomic and physiologic assessment of the thyroid
Karen J. Clark, MD, John J. Cronan, MD *, Francis H. Scola, MD
